F or over 20 years Historic Brighton has offered programs and published quarterly newsletter/journals on our mission to explore our town’s history and educate our community about Brighton’s past.

Our organization includes professional historians, researchers, librarians, architects, long-time Brighton residents, and many others who possess a strong curiosity about their surroundings.

We have covered the Seneca Indians, our neighborhoods and sites, local cultural and religious institutions, historic personages, architectural history, historic preservation and many other subjects.

Did You Know?

That Brighton had a 127 acre aerodrome that was considered the second best airfield in New York State?illustration of antique biplane
